.map_solu{
	background: #cfeaf3;
	position: relative;
}
.map_solu .img_map{
	width: 55%;
	height: 650px;

}
.map_solu .img_map img{
	width: 100%;
	height: 100%;
	object-fit: cover
}
.map_solu .content_map {
	position: absolute;
	top: 0;
	left: 0;
	width: 100%;
	height: 100%;
	padding:80px 0;
}
.map_solu .content_map .title_map{
	color: #003770;
	font-size: 36px;
	margin-bottom: 15px
}
.map_solu .content_map .margin-right{
	margin: auto;
    margin-right: 0;
}
.besoin{
	background-color: #f3f6eb;
    border: 2px solid #fff;
    border-width: 2px 0;
    padding: 2em 0;
}
.besoin .title_besion{
	color: #003770;
    font-size: 24px;
    margin-bottom: 10px
}
.besoin .info_show{
	display: flex;
}
.besoin .info_show img{
	width: 140px;
	margin-right: 20px;
	object-fit: cover;
	display: inline-block;
	border-radius: 100%
}
.besoin .info_show .info{
	padding:22px 0;
}
.besoin .info_show .name{
	display: block;
    font-weight: bold;
    margin-bottom: 5px;
}
.besoin .info_show a{
	color: #0e69b2;
	display: block;
	text-decoration: none
}
.besoin .info_show i{
	color: #555;
	margin-right: 4px
}
.besoin .content_right{
	padding-top: 45px;
	font-style: italic;
}
.country_amazing{
	background: #f2f2f4;
}
.country_tournos{
	background:#fff;
}

/*guide*/

.guide{
	position: relative;
	padding:80px 0;
}
.guide .title_guide{
	color: #003770;
	margin-bottom: 30px
}
.guide .inner{
	margin-bottom: 30px
}
.guide .inner a{
	display: block;
	width: 100%;
	text-align: center;
	text-decoration: none;
}
.guide .inner img{
	width: 115px;
	height: 115px;
	object-fit: cover;
	border-radius: 100%;
	margin-bottom: 15px
}
.guide .inner h3{
	color: #0056b3;
	font-size: 24px;
	line-height: 1.1;
    font-weight: 400;
    transition: all .2s ease-in
}
.guide .inner h3:hover{
	color: #29aae1;
}
















